Wayne,


You may want to look at the old USL threads concerning switches.

What they did was simplicity itself seeking a minimun of resistance the switch was hard wired between the battery pak and lamp via a kiu type socket and heat sink. I think it was a 10A rocker type switch.

Depending on which batteries you intend on running you might want to leave a little bit of resistance in the system. I've seen plenty of people blow their bulbs using CBP1650's. Those who didnt do the resistance mods dont have that problem near as frequently.
